During a call, you can alternate between Speakerphone, Headset, or Handset modes
by pressing the speakerphone key, the HEADSET key, or picking up the handset.
The call duration of active call is visible on the LCD screen. In the figure below, the call to
Kame has lasted 9 seconds.

You can also dial using the SIP URI or IP address. To obtain the IP address of your phone,
press the OK key. The maximum SIP URI or IP address length is 32 characters. For
example, IP: 192.168.1.15, SIP URI: 2210@sip.com.
Your phone may not support direct IP dialing. Contact your system administrator for more
information.
